Ordinals
beta
Sat 642320990825821
decimal
128464.990825821
degree
0°128464′1456″990825821‴
percentile
30.58671388249402%
name
jhlhexzapwu
cycle
0
epoch
0
period
63
block
128464
offset
990825821
timestamp
2011-06-04 01:57:44 UTC
rarity
common
prev
next